The circumstances that gave rise to hezbollah stem from the fragile and unstable nature of the lebanese political system following the countrys civil war and the volatile nature of the region in the light of the complicated arabisraeli conflict. Hezbollah was largely formed with the aid of the ayatollah ruhollah khomeinis followers in the early 1980s in order to spread the islamic revolution and follows a distinct version of islamic shia ideology valiyat alfaqih or guardianship of the islamic jurists developed by ayatollah khomeini, leader of the islamic. Feb, 2005 as of august 2002, iran was reported to have financed and established terrorist training camps in the syriancontrolled bekaa valley to train hezbollah, hamas, pij and pflpgc terrorists to use rockets such as the short range fajr5 missile and the sa7 antiaircraft rocket. A comparative analysis of hezbollah and hamas responses to the syrian uprising nasrin akhter, university of st andrews introduction this paper seeks to examine the contradictory responses of hezbollah and hamas towards the asad regime in light of the syrian uprising. Hamas and hezbollah are often perceived and categorized as being alike, as a result of similarities in their organizational structure, ideology, and activities.
